Safety
Bunk beds are a popular choice for bedrooms for children because they can save space. However, they can pose safety risks if not properly used. To avoid these risks make sure that your bunk bed is inspected and meets all safety standards. It is crucial to regularly check the bunk bed for indications of damage or faulty construction. It is also important to educate your children on how to use the bunk bed safely and also encourage them to adhere to safety rules.
Single bunk beds for children should feature guardrails on both sides of the mattress, which should be at least five inches higher than the mattress. This will prevent children from falling off the bed when they are sleeping. Also, you should ensure that the ladder's opening is at least 16cm from the edge of your bed frame. Install the rails securely and ensure they are free of any gaps that could allow children to become trapped.
You should also choose bunk beds constructed of sturdy materials that can withstand the weight and size of the children who sleep on it. It is also recommended to purchase a high-quality mattress for each level, which must be designed to accommodate the number of people who sleep on it. Also, take into consideration the dimensions of the room as well as the ceiling height when selecting the bunk bed.
It is essential to follow the instructions of the manufacturer to ensure safety and assembly when using bunk beds. It is also important to teach your children to use the ladder and encourage them to be cautious when climbing over the rails. You should also regularly inspect the bunk bed for signs of wear and poor construction. Repair any issues that are needed.
It is also important to remove any potential tripping hazards from the area surrounding the bunk bed, such as clothes and shoes. You should also encourage your children to tidy their rooms prior to going to sleep. Also, remind them of these safety rules when they invite their friends to a sleepover.

Maintenance
Bunk beds can be a beautiful solution for bedrooms and other living areas however, they should be kept in good condition. Regular inspections are essential to find and fix any issues. This includes ensuring that the bed is designed for the intended use and that the stairs or ladder are safe. It is important to teach your children to use bunk beds properly, including not jumping off of the top or climbing up the frame.
childrens wooden bunk beds bed maintenance consists of regular cleaning and deodorizing the mattresses. This will prevent the accumulation of dust, dirt and allergens that can result in poor sleep quality. Regular airing, vacuuming, and spot cleaning of stains also aids in prolonging the life of your mattress. Mattress protectors are recommended to shield fabric from deterioration and keep it clean and also make it more comfortable.
One of the most common problems with maintenance that affects bunk beds is squeaking. This could be the result of loose joints and tightening these can help resolve the problem. Additionally, lubricating the joints with oil can reduce the amount of friction that causes them to be squeaky.
Other common maintenance issues can include scratches and dents. You can easily solve these issues by using touch-up markers or wood fillers. Also, be careful not to place the bunk bed in direct sunlight since it can cause damage to furniture.
